    Governemt Salaries:
    US President            $400,000 + $50,000 non-taxable expenses
    Vice-President            $230,700 + $10,000 non-taxable expenses
    Speaker of the House        $223,500
    Majority/Minority Leaders    $193,400
    Senators & Representatives    $174,000
ref: http://usgovinfo.about.com/od/uscongress/a/congresspay.htm

    Average Teachers Salaries:
    Elemtary Teacher         $40,088
    High School Teacher         $43,389
ref: http://www.payscale.com/research/US/All_K-12_Teachers/Salary

    Salaries for Active Duty Soldiers (with 4 years experience)
    PFC (E3)            $23,400
    Sergeant (E5)            $29,380
    Staff Sergeant (E6)        $32,742
    2nd Lieutenant (O1)        $42,030
    Captain (O3)            $59,422
ref: http://www.goarmy.com/benefits/money/basic-pay-active-duty-soldiers.html
